Understanding RTP: Definition and Industry Standards
RTP, or Return to Player, is a percentage that indicates the theoretical amount a slot machine or game is designed to return to players over an extended period of play. For example, an RTP of 96% suggests that, on average, for every £100 wagered, the game will theoretically pay back £96 in the long run.
However, it’s crucial to recognise that RTP is a **mathematical expectation**, calculated over millions of spins. It does not predict specific outcomes for individual sessions, which remain subject to chance and variance. Nonetheless, RTP serves as a vital yardstick for gauging a game’s fairness and potential profitability.

Transparency and Fairness in UK Online Slots
The UK’s regulatory framework ensures that online slots operate with fairness and transparency. Licensing bodies such as the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) enforce strict standards whereby game developers must publish RTP figures clearly. This is part of the broader commitment to consumer protection and integrity in the industry.
In practice, most licensed game providers design slots with RTPs between 94% and 98%, striking a balance between player engagement and casino profitability. The Practical Impact of RTP on PlayerExperience
While RTP is a vital metric, it should not be viewed in isolation. Variance, hit frequency, bonus features, and game mechanics collectively shape the player experience.
| Attribute | Description | Typical Range |
|---|---|---|
| RTP | Theoretical payout percentage over the long term | 94% – 98% |
| Variance / Volatility | Frequency and size of wins | Low to High |
| Hit Frequency | Percentage of spins that result in a win | 20% – 35% |
Choosing a slot with the right combination of these factors can enhance enjoyment and align with one’s gaming philosophy.
